Instructions
Heat the olive oil in a pan to medium heat. Add the ground beef and cook for 5 minutes until nicely browned and mostly cooked through, breaking it apart with a wooden spoon. Drain excess fat and liquid.
Add the taco seasonings, salt and pepper to taste, and stir. Cook 2-3 minutes to let the spices bloom.
Stir in the refried beans and water. Mix to incorporate, then reduce the heat. Simmer for 10 minutes to develop flavor. You can simmer longer if you’d like to develop flavor further.
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
Layer the tortilla chips onto a large baking sheet.
Spread the cooked meat and beans mixture evenly over the tortilla chips.
Top evenly with the shredded cheeses.
Top with pickled jalapeno peppers. Add as few or as many as you’d like.
Bake the nachos tray for 10 minutes, or until the cheeses are nicely melted and gooey.
Remove from heat, top with your favorite toppings, and serve!
